This Demonstration studies a superposition of two quantum harmonic oscillator eigenstates in the position and momentum representations. The superposition consists of two eigenstates , where and is the Hermite polynomial; the representations are connected via . The top-left panel shows the position space probability density , position expectation value , and position uncertainty . The top-right panel shows the momentum space probability density , momentum expectation value , and momentum uncertainty . The lower two panels show the real and imaginary parts of the wavefunction.
